Johnson named Albany State University Player of the Week after outstanding two-way performance
Dru Johnson pitched three scoreless, hit bases-loaded double to lead Pirates to 8-4 win
COLQUITT, Ga. (WALB) - Miller County defeated Baconton Charter 8-4 on Thursday night in a game with region implications, reclaiming first place behind a two-way performance from Dru Johnson.
Baconton had beaten Miller 2-1 on Tuesday, making Thursday’s game at Miller critical for region standings.
Johnson took the mound for the Pirates and gave up two runs in the first inning before delivering three straight scoreless innings.
“I lost my rhythm in the first one for a bit but when I got back into the dugout I was just thinking like okay, they aren’t gonna score on me no more,” Johnson said.
Johnson gave Miller its first lead of the game in the bottom of the fourth inning with a two-out, bases-loaded double that scored three runs.
Johnson returned to the mound in the seventh inning to close out the game.
Miller reclaimed first place in the region with the win. The Pirates can win the region if they win three of their next four games.
When asked what his performance says about his abilities as a two-way player, Johnson said, “I’m him.”
